The Buffalo single induction hob is a compact, plug-in cooking unit built for professional catering environments where flexibility and energy efficiency are practical priorities. It operates through a ceramic glass surface with touch controls and connects via a standard 13A plug, removing the need for any hardwired electrical installation. Induction cooking transfers heat directly to the pan rather than the surrounding surface, so the 3kW element delivers responsive, controlled output with less energy waste than conventional radiant or gas hobs. Recovery between cooking tasks is quick, and 19 selectable power levels give operators precise control when moving between searing, simmering, and holding during a busy service. The cooler ambient surface temperature also helps reduce heat build-up at the cooking station — a noticeable advantage in an already hot kitchen at peak hours. From an operational standpoint, the main advantages are: Plug-in connection means no electrical contractor and no installation downtime Lightweight and portable — practical for mobile units, pop-ups, and front-of-house use Smooth ceramic glass surface cleans down quickly between services Precise power control reduces overcooking risk during quieter covers Induction efficiency keeps running costs lower compared to gas or radiant electric alternatives One consideration worth addressing before purchase: induction cooking requires cookware with a ferrous base. Standard aluminium or copper pans will not function on this hob. Operators switching from gas should check their existing batterie de cuisine before committing. This unit is not designed to replace a full range in a high-volume kitchen, but works reliably as a supplementary cooking station or as the primary hob in lower-throughput environments. This hob is well suited to smaller catering operations, mobile caterers, pop-up kitchens, hospitality suites, and front-of-house cooking demonstrations where portability and a clean finish matter. For sites running consistently high covers across multiple cooking zones, a heavier-duty or multi-zone induction solution is likely to be more appropriate.
